Hamilton Housing Development is a housing development organization based in New York, New York, dedicated to addressing residential needs within the city. Located at 141 W 73rd St, this organization focuses on creating and managing affordable housing solutions tailored to the diverse population of New York. The development projects undertaken aim to provide safe, accessible, and community-oriented living environments, contributing to the overall improvement of urban housing conditions.
